Bio
• First player in the Bill Maddock era to produce a hat trick, at Endicott, Sept. 23, 2023
CAREER HIGHS
Assists: 1, six times
Goals: 3, at Endicott, Sept. 23, 2023
Points: 6, at Endicott, Sept. 23, 2023
Shots: 6, at Salem State, Sept. 14, 2024
Point Streak: 2 games, twice, last Oct. 7-11, 2025

JUNIOR • 2024
Competed in all 22 games, started 15 ... Registered 10 points ... Scored three goals, all game winners ... Dished out four assists ... Took 36 shots, put 14 on target ... SOPHOMORE • 2023
All-CCC Third-Team ... Appeared in 19 games, started eight ... Shared second on the team in points with 13 ... Scored six goals, good for a share of second on the squad ... Handed out one assist ... Took 26 shots, put 15 on target ... Scored one goal in the season-opener, a 3-1 win at Emmanuel (Sept. 1) ... Had a hand in the 1-0 shutout over Salem State (Sept. 2) ...
